Retainer bands are essential components used in orthodontics to maintain the position of teeth after braces have been removed. They help prevent teeth from shifting back to their original position, ensuring lasting results from orthodontic treatment.

FAQs

How can I choose the best retainer bands for my needs?

Consult with your orthodontist to determine the best type and size of retainer bands that suit your dental structure and treatment plan.

What are the key features to look for when selecting retainer bands?

Look for durability, comfort, and the right fit. It's also essential to choose bands made from high-quality materials.

Are there any common mistakes people make when purchasing retainer bands?

One common mistake is not consulting with an orthodontist, leading to incorrect sizing or type. Always seek professional advice.

How often should I replace my retainer bands?

It's recommended to replace retainer bands every few months or as advised by your orthodontist to ensure effectiveness.

Can I clean my retainer bands?

Yes, you can clean them using a soft toothbrush and mild soap. Avoid harsh chemicals to maintain their quality.
